Address NF3CBjsiqUxSd6RiUEzpPmPYdaL5AKndM1

Total received 12.62932399 NMC
Total sent 12.62932399 NMC
Balance: 0.00000000 NMC
Date/time Transaction Block Debit Credit Balance
July 11, 2023, 10:19 a.m. 7b6254355… 673407 6.25000000 NMC 0.00000000 NMC
July 11, 2023, 10:19 a.m. bb05c1e30… 673407 6.37932399 NMC 0.00000000 NMC
Oct. 8, 2022, 8:34 p.m. 9ef5e911b… 633305 6.37932399 NMC 12.62932399 NMC
Oct. 8, 2022, 7:16 p.m. 7a0f4a0d4… 633298 6.25000000 NMC 6.25000000 NMC